The short version
Louise is a city of 977 people in Texas. Four-year degrees are less common here than nationally, at 10% of adults. The typical home is worth $51,200. Households here earn about 30% less than in Texas as a whole. Owners hold 76% of the housing stock. Median household income is $27,750, under the $42,589 national median.

Frequently asked
How many people live in Louise, Texas? Louise, Texas has about 977 residents according to the 2000 Census.
What is the median household income in Louise, Texas? The typical household in Louise, Texas earns about $27,750 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Louise, Texas expensive? In Louise, Texas, the median home is worth about $51,200, and the typical rent is about $528 a month.
How educated are people in Louise, Texas? About 9.6% of adults age 25 and over in Louise, Texas h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Louise, Texas? About 15.3% of people in Louise, Texas live below the federal poverty line.
